Impress your co-workers at the water cooler.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><mark><strong><mark><mark style=\"background-color:#ffffff\" class=\"has-inline-color has-vivid-red-color\">Featured Restaurant News<\/mark><\/mark><\/strong><\/mark><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li>Unfortunately, this week&#8217;s &#8220;big news&#8221; are a couple of big-time closings. But the hope is we will see each &#8220;soon&#8221; in some way, shape or fashion. First came the news out of Durham that <strong>Matt Kelly&#8217;s<\/strong> <strong>St. James Seafood Seafood<\/strong> would not have their lease renewed and their last day of operation will be in early October. Looks like there are plans for a new mixed-use development on that piece of real estate. Within hours, came news out of downtown Raleigh that <strong>Cheetie Kumar<\/strong> and husband <strong>Paul Siler<\/strong> would be closing <strong>Garland<\/strong>. Their last day of operation is August 27. The good news is that both will have a reincarnation of sorts. <strong>Kumar<\/strong> and <strong>Siler<\/strong> and working on a project with the folks at <strong>Annisette Sweet Shop<\/strong> on Bickett Boulevard in Raleigh, which should be unveiled in the very near future. And it sounds like <strong>Kelly<\/strong> is eager to find a new home for <strong>St. James<\/strong>. They did so yesterday, Thursday.  <\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li>Down in Selma in Johnston County, got the announcement this week that the much-anticipated <strong>Old North State Food Hall<\/strong> will open its doors on <strong>Friday, August 26<\/strong>. The hall is located at 67 JR Road in Selma and will offer ten diverse cuisines all under one roof. Opening tenants include <strong>FUKU<\/strong>, <strong>Barley and Burger<\/strong>, <strong>Luna Pizza<\/strong>, <strong>Curry in a Hurry<\/strong>, <strong>Aroma de Cuba<\/strong>, <strong>The Mac House<\/strong>, <strong>My Cielo Taqueria<\/strong>, <strong>Cock a Doodle Moo<\/strong>, <strong>Bean and Bubble<\/strong> and <strong>Butter Cream<\/strong>. <strong>Longleaf Tavern<\/strong>, housed in what was once a humidor in the historic JR Cigars building, will serve as the \u201cheart of the food hall,\u201d offering full bar service. <strong><a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.onsfh.com\/\" target=\"_blank\"><mark style=\"background-color:#ffffff\" class=\"has-inline-color has-vivid-cyan-blue-color\">Get updates and announcements here<\/mark><\/a><\/strong>. <\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p><strong><mark><mark style=\"background-color:#ffffff\" class=\"has-inline-color has-vivid-red-color\">Durham, Orange &amp; Chatham Restaurant News<\/mark><\/mark><\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li><strong>Raleigh Magazine<\/strong> shared some huge news out of <strong>Boxyard RTP<\/strong> this week with the announcement that <strong>Lawrence Barbecue&#8217;s Jake Wood<\/strong> will be opening a new taco spot early next year! <strong>Leroy&#8217;s Tacos n Beer <\/strong>will specialize in the smoked brisket birria tacos that he served as a special at <strong>Lawrence<\/strong> (sold out in a couple of hours), along with rotating dishes. Durham NC breweries: <strong>Glass Jug<\/strong>, <strong>Ponysaurus<\/strong>, <strong>Fullsteam<\/strong>, and <strong>Bull City Burger and Brewery<\/strong>; and Durham UK Breweries: <strong>Caps Off<\/strong>, <strong>Hops and Dots<\/strong>, <strong>Steam Machine<\/strong>, and <strong>Durham Brewery<\/strong>. <strong><a rel=\"noreferrer no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.facebook.com\/events\/s\/two-durhams-beer-festival\/6088959797786080\" target=\"_blank\"><mark style=\"background-color:#ffffff\" class=\"has-inline-color has-vivid-cyan-blue-color\">Visit their event page on Facebook here<\/mark><\/a><\/strong>. <\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li>The <strong>Willard Wine Dinner: Italy\u2019s Piemonte <\/strong>will take place at 6:30 p.m. Wednesday, <strong>Aug. 25<\/strong>. Chef <strong>James Cundiff<\/strong> will prepare a four-course menu that will be paired with six Italian wines, including Bianco, Barbera D\u2019Alba, Barbaresco, Barolo and finishing with a Brachetto. Tickets are limited to 40 people. Wine will be available for purchase at a discounted rate.
